If you want to see how loud the TDR will be without actually spending money on one, there is an easier way.
You will need 6" of 1 1/2" PVC SCH 80 pipe and 2- 1 1/2" couplings.
Glue the couplings on both ends of the PVC pipe and insert it in place of your waterbox.
It's a perfect fit on the square without the need to cut hoses.

That sounds just like a TDR and is only slightly louder.
